The Rise of Digital Solutions in Recreational and Commercial Fishing
The global fishing industry, comprising both recreational enthusiasts and commercial operators, increasingly relies on digital applications for competitive advantage. According to fisheries technology market reports, the industry’s tech segment is projected to grow at a compound annual rate of over 12% until 2030, indicating rapid adoption of innovative tools.1 These tools range from advanced sonar systems to community-driven data platforms that influence everything from target species selection to sustainable practices.
Specifically, targeted mobile apps are transforming how anglers access localized data, share catches, and refine techniques. This digital shift enhances the industry’s transparency and efficiency, making it more accessible and environmentally conscious.

Strategic Integration: Enhancing Sustainability and Industry Growth
The data-rich environment fostered by mobile applications supports conservation efforts by tracking catch data, monitoring species populations, and promoting responsible catch-and-release practices. These initiatives are vital as the fishing industry confronts sustainability challenges intensified by climate change and habitat degradation.
Furthermore, digital platforms enable commercial fisheries to comply with regulations more effectively, reducing waste and improving traceability. This synergy between technology and regulation promotes a more responsible industry capable of long-term growth.
